Overview
Mesa Energy Systems is a wholly owned subsidiary of EMCOR Group, Inc. EMCOR is the world’s leading provider of mechanical and electrical construction and facilities services, including planning, consulting, and operations and maintenance. Mesa Energy Systems is a HVAC mechanical services company that provides fully integrated solutions for preventative maintenance and repair, upgrading existing mechanical, electrical, and controls systems to provide the most efficient economic solutions to meet customer expectations. Account Manager Principal Duties And Responsibilities
Prospect for new accounts, provide clients with product services/information, maintain existing client relationships, develop sales presentations, and follow through with each client and opportunity. Maintain client pricing and payments, A/R management, client correspondence, quality assurance (QA) support, and participate in industry and trade shows. Account Manager respon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following. Agreement and alignment with EMCOR Mesa’s written philosophy of sales, established processes, and procedures related to sales. Research prospective clients and/or projects through various methods, including contacting Chief Engineers, Property Managers, and Asset Managers. Make phone calls, visits, attend conferences, utilize the Internet, and leverage existing relationships. Introduce, develop, and maintain relationships with prospective clients. Collaborate with the Sales Manager and Branch Manager along with other team members to review and improve account programs and processes to meet targeted objectives. Manage through analysis and solution-based programs to maximize sales growth, volume, and profitability of account clients. Prepare and deliver client presentations. Develop, write, and review client proposal documents including financial and technical sections, using standard templates and pricing models. Develop sales at defined margin levels to attain market share. Communicate professionally with various departments within EMCOR/Mesa, such as Operations, chiller teams, project management, sales teams, and others. Demonstrate a personal commitment to growth and development, including attending product and sales training events, and participating in all professional training provided by EMCOR/Mesa. Achieve written annual sales plans. Compensation
An annual draw is established by management for each account manager, provided in equal, weekly payments. Each account manager receives an annual non-maintenance sales plan, an annual maintenance sales plan, and an automation and controls sales plan. Sales plans equal or exceed the annual draw. It is the account manager’s responsibility to produce project, service, maintenance, automation, and repair sales that meet or exceed the stated annual sales plan. The dollar value of the sales plans will be established by management and will be sufficient to pay for the cost of the account manager’s employment. Achieving the given sales plans annually is required as a condition of employment. The account manager will be compensated as detailed in Mesa’s posted sales compensation plan. Job Specifications
